I ran into a woman at the Vino store today who asked about my car and did I know anyone who might want to buy a 74 2.0 with 75K on it....Orange and black....she said it was a California Special. Now, I bought a 2.0 in '74 and I got the S version (came with all the stuff that was free in 73...but I don't remember a Cal Special model or package...I figure it's either a 2.0 S or maybe an LE...that is the only other special one in 74 that I know of....soooo....maybe I'll have 2 pretty soon. Oh yeah, she's the original owner and its been in the garage for 12 years...she says virtually no rust.....we'll see. Can one of our historians remember anything about a Cal Special version????
